You have to make 1000 buttons.the diameter of the button is 9cm but you have to find it’s area.its $15/m squared and you have to
Semmy [17]

Answer:

$95.38

Step-by-step explanation:

step 1

Find the area of one button

The area is equal to

A=\pi r^{2}

we have

r=9/2=4.5\ cm ---> the radius is half the diameter

Convert to meters

r=4.5\ cm=4.5/100=0.045\ m

assume

\pi =3.14

substitute

A=(3.14)(0.045)^{2}\\A=0.0063585\ m^2

step 2

Find the area of 1,00 buttons

Multiply by 1,000

A=0.0063585(1,000)=6.3585\ m^2

step 3

Find the cost

Multiply $15 per square meter by the total area of 1,000 buttons

(15)6.3585=\$95.38

If 2 - 3i is a solution to the equation x3 - 3x2 + 9x + 13 = 0, what are the other roots of the equation?
OLga [1]
The complex solutions come in pairs and the only difference between them is the sign between the real and imaginary part, so one of the other two solutions is 2+3i. The third solution can be easily found using the rational root theorem, and it's equal to -1.
